Not available in winter. Enjoy the Bitterroot Valley from this comfortable and spacious new 850 square foot 1 bedroom 1 bath apartment with full kitchen. This apartment is the walkout basement of a single family home on over 3 natural acres with a beautiful view of the Bitterroot Mountains from large windows in the living room and bedroom. Private driveway entrance and parking contribute to the peaceful setting. The full kitchen has all the basic staples, housewares and appliances so you can cook as much as you’d like, or enjoy the many fine local restaurants. The private patio has a new full size barbecue and the same fantastic view of the Bitterroots. Washer, dryer and full bath with combination shower and tub are supplied with laundry products and basic toiletries. Living room and kitchen are comfortable 50s style maple furniture. The bedroom has a queen size bed with memory foam, full dresser and closet. Mattresses and pillows have Aller-ease covers, and there are plenty of extra blankets and pillows. The living room has a fold out sofa bed that sleeps 1 adult or 2 children, upholstered chair and full couch, 40 inch TV, DVD player, Netflix, wireless internet, and a selection of DVDs, games and books. Since this is a basement apartment, there are occasional noises from the upstairs even though there is extra insulation between floors. Dogs live on the property and occasionally bark. Guests are expected to be respectful of the shared space. There is no TV service, but there is a selection of DVDs and Netflix, and a wi-fi password is available. No air conditioning, but there are ceiling fans in each room and a portable fan for use if desired. Being a walkout basement, the rooms stay quite cool year round. Located 10 minutes east of downtown Stevensville and 5 miles east of Highway 93, only minutes from Bitterroot fishing and hiking and 30 miles south of Missoula. So much to do and see in the area, with world famous fishing, hiking, biking, hunting, river rafting, museums, and fine restaurants, from casual to elegant.
